CU 600/1000V XLPE Insulation Armor-x PVC Jacket. XHHW-2

Type MC-HL Power Cable 600Volt Three Conductor Copper, Cross Linked Polyethylene (XLPE) insulation XHHW-2 Continuous Corrugated Welded Armor (Armor-X), Polyvinyl Chloride (PVC) Jacket with 3 Bare CU Ground

Construction:

  1. Conductor:Class B compressed stranded bare copper per ASTM B3 and ASTM B8
  2. Insulation:Cross Linked Polyethylene (XLPE) Type XHHW-2
  3. Grounding Conductor:Class B compressed stranded bare copper per ASTM B3 and ASTM B8
  4. Filler:Paper filler (cable size 8 & 6 uses Polypropylene filler)
  5. Binder:Polypropylene tape
  6. Armor:Continuous Corrugated Welded Armor (Armor-X)
  7. Overall Jacket:Polyvinyl Chloride (PVC) Jacket

Applications and Features:

Southwire’s 600 Volt Type MC-HL Armor-X® power cables are suited for use in wet and dry areas, conduits, ducts, troughs, trays, direct burial, aerial supported by a messenger, and where superior electrical properties are desired. These cables are capable of operating continuously at the conductor temperature not in excess of 90°C for normal operation in wet and dry locations, 130°C for emergency overload, 250°C for short circuit conditions, and -50°C for cold bend. For uses in Class I, II, and III, Division 1 and 2 hazardous locations per NEC Article 501, 502, and 503. Suitable for VFD application.

Specifications:

  • ASTM B3 Standard Specification for Soft or Annealed Copper Wire
  • ASTM B8 Concentric-Lay-Stranded Copper Conductors
  • UL 44 Thermoset-Insulated Wires and Cables
  • UL 1569 Metal-Clad Cables
  • UL 1685 FT4 Vertical-Tray Fire Propagation and Smoke Release Test
  • CSA C22.2 No. 123 Metal sheathed cables RA90-HL
  • ICEA S-58-679 Control Cable Conductor Identification Method 3 (1-BLACK, 2-RED, 3-BLUE)
  • ICEA S-58-679 Control Cable Conductor Identification Method 4
  • ICEA S-95-658 (NEMA WC70) Power Cables Rated 2000 Volts or Less for the Distribution of Electrical Energy
  • IEEE 1202 FT4 Vertical Tray Flame Test (70,000 Btu/hr) and ICEA T-29-520 - (210,000 Btu/hr)
